# Postdoctoral Fellowship: OCE-PRF: A Parameterization of Tidal and Equatorial Internal Wave Turbulence

## Abstract

Underwater mixing plays a critical role in regulating Earth’s climate by distributing heat, nutrients, and dissolved gases throughout the ocean. This mixing is largely driven by the breaking of internal waves, which are generated by wind and tides. However, many ocean models cannot resolve the wave breaking that drives mixing and must instead rely on simplified representations called parameterizations. One such model is the Generalized Finescale Parameterization (GFP), which infers mixing rates from measurements of the internal wave field. While effective, and an improvement on past parameterizations, the current GFP has two major limitations: it neglects energy sources beyond wind forcing and omits the equatorial ocean, where wave dynamics differ substantially. This project aims to improve the GFP by incorporating additional energy sources, such as tidal flows, and by incorporating unique wave dynamics at equatorial latitudes. These enhancements will provide a more complete understanding of the drivers of ocean mixing, reduce key uncertainties in climate models, and offer new insight into the energetic pathways that lead to mixing. The project also supports education and training through undergraduate mentorship and participation in an international oceanographic summer school.
